The Exchange, looking east, Nottingham, Nottinghamshire, 1845. This was Nottingham's 'great Market Place' where, from medieval times right through the 1920s a Saturday market was held, as well as the October 'Goose Fair' which, in the 19th century, became a fun fair. Street names like The Poultry, Cheapside and Beastmarket Hill recall the use of the area as a market. This view was taken from Beastmarket Hill. In the 1920s the Exchange was demolished and replaced with a new building, the Council House.
